Hi and welcome to the forum.

It will depend upon what it says in your paperwork. Most IVA's these days allow for three missed payments before a breach is issued and the IVA fails.

You would have to make up the missed payment by either tagging it on at the end or making extra monthly payments.

IPs cannot consent to payment breaks, unless in accordance with the terms of the IVA protocol. If you do miss a payment, your account will fall into arrears and you will need to come to an arrangement with your IP to repay these.
